Cognitive Bias and the Web: Exploring the Psychology Behind W3 Information Processing
The World Wide Web offers a immense selection of information, constantly hitting users with data. This colossal influx of content can significantly influence how we interpret data, often leading to cognitive biases. These mental shortcuts developed by our brains frequently skew our understanding of the world.
- For example, confirmation bias could cause users primarily seeking out information that confirms their existing beliefs.
- Similarly, the availability heuristic influences our judgments based on how easily we can remember information. This tends to lead to inflating the likelihood of events that are vividly remembered.
Understanding these cognitive biases is essential for navigating the web successfully. By identifying our own biases, we can reduce their effect on our perceptions and make more informed judgments.
